MALACAÑANG Manila BY THE PRESIDENT OF THE PHILIPPINES PROCLAMATION NO. 1403 DECLARING MONDAY, OCTOBER 29, 2007, AS A SPECIAL (NON-WORKING) HOLIDAY THROUGHOUT THE COUNTRY WHEREAS, the Sangguniang Kabataan and Barangay Elections shall be held on Monday, October 29, 2007;
WHEREAS, it is important to give the people the fullest opportunity to participate in the said elections and exercise their right to vote. NOW, THEREFORE, I, GLORIA MACAPAGAL-ARROYO, President of the Republic of the Philippines, by virtue of the powers vested in me by law, do hereby declare Monday, October 29, 2007, as a special (non-working) holiday throughout the country. IN WITNESS WHEREOF, I have hereunto set my hand and caused the seal of the Republic of the Philippines to be affixed. Done in the City of Manila, this 16th day of October, in the year of Our Lord, Two Thousand and Seven. |
